Not included in that nineteen were the rehearsals for the Flotation Walls CD Release show at Skully's in early June. What a blast this was! One of three rehearsal videos is below -- the others are here and here:



For the CD release show, at least fifteen performers packed on one stage and plowed through intricate tunes on violins, cello, viola, flute, keyboard, accordion, trumpet, tuba, french horn, trombone, harp, drums, electric and acoustic guitar and bass, and vocals.


Thanks to Jess Miller, you can view more pictures of the show here. Thanks also to Brainbow and The Receiver for their sets before us that night.

This recording is seven years in the making, and the band of four members is now on tour. You can purchase the CD "NATURE" here, and listen to tracks on the Flotation Walls MySpace page. Harp appears on the opening track "Sperm & Egg" as well as "I've Seen Death and His Tremendous Pink Eyes."

Harp appeared in every tune at the show, and was the featured accompaniment for "Timmy Twofingers" (see rehearsal video above). My notes for this tune are below, the basic chords of which were handwritten by Carlos himself! This is exactly what I am looking at in this video. For all tunes, the band graciously left the doors wide open for me to create and insert my own parts.

The place that night was packed, perfect for this high-energy band that draws out a consistent and inspiring level of audience interaction. I'm ecstatic for their success and so grateful to have been a part of this experience -- it very much informs and shapes the next steps for my own work.
